Panthers Take Two at Lake Erie, Complete Sixth Conference Sweep

PAINESVILLE, OH - The Ohio Dominican Panthers secured their sixth conference sweep of the season with a doubleheader win over the Lake Erie Storm in Painesville. ODU took game one in extra innings, 4–3, before finishing the sweep with an 8–0 run-rule victory in six innings.

Game One (W, 4-3 in extra innings)
Lake Erie jumped ahead early with a two-run home run in the first, but ODU responded gradually. The Panthers got on the board in the third on a wild pitch, then tied it in the fifth when Erica Massey drove in a run with a single. The Storm answered to retake a 3–2 lead, setting up a late push from ODU.

In the seventh, the Panthers rallied with two outs as Kendrick Sterling and Halina Schulte singled, and Massey delivered again with the game-tying RBI. In extras, Reese Loveday tripled to spark the inning before Sterling brought her home with the go-ahead double. Alyvia Lawrentz closed it out, allowing three runs on six hits with seven strikeouts. Massey finished 4-for-4 with two RBIs, while Sterling added three hits and the game-winner.

Game Two (W, 8-0 in six innings)
The Panthers carried their momentum into game two and took control early. Emma Grau was dominant in the circle, tossing a complete-game shutout over six innings, allowing just three hits and striking out four on an efficient 46 pitches.

Offensively, ODU broke the game open in the second inning, scoring four runs on five hits. Addie Triplett started the inning by driving Erica Massey in for a run, while Leea Ibarra added an RBI in her return from injury. Grau also contributed at the plate with a two-RBI single to cap the inning.

The Panthers continued to add on in the third, extending the lead to 6–0 behind another key hit from Massey and a two-RBI effort from Triplett. They sealed the run-rule victory in the sixth with two more runs, highlighted by an RBI bunt from Schulte and a run-scoring groundout from Gianna Solinger.

Massey remained a standout, going 3-for-4 in game two, while Triplett and Grau each recorded two RBIs. ODU finished with nine hits and seven RBIs in the contest.
